Karsanpura Population - Mahesana, Gujarat
Karsanpura is a medium size village located in Kadi Taluka of Mahesana district, Gujarat with total 211 families residing. The Karsanpura village has population of 950 of which 472 are males while 478 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Karsanpura village population of children with age 0-6 is 93 which makes up 9.79 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Karsanpura village is 1013 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Karsanpura as per census is 1022, higher than Gujarat average of 890.
Karsanpura village has higher liter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Karsanpura village was 82.61 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Karsanpura Male literacy stands at 89.20 % while female literacy rate was 76.10 %.

Karsanpura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 211 | - | - |
Population | 950 | 472 | 478 |
Child (0-6) | 93 | 46 | 47 |
Schedule Caste | 161 | 78 | 83 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 82.61 % | 89.20 % | 76.10 % |
Total Workers | 549 | 289 | 260 |
Main Worker | 457 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 92 | 22 | 70 |
